What Does This Mean?

Chicago offers a Aerospace Engineer salary of $123K USD, while Dallas offers $121K USD β€” a difference of +1% in raw terms.

After adjusting for purchasing power parity (PPP), Chicago's salary is worth $123K in US purchasing power terms, versus $121K for Dallas. This means Chicago offers better real purchasing power for this role.

PPP adjustment accounts for differences in local prices β€” for example, housing costs 3x more in San Francisco than in Warsaw, so a San Francisco salary needs to be much higher to provide an equivalent standard of living.
